I have read up to chapter 89 and the book has been enjoyable so far. My only issue is the main characters personality which sometimes breaks the immersion for me. As a grand sage in his previous life, I had some expectation that his personality would not be so childish. I can understand his overtly excited and emotional behaviour when it comes to magic, as that is the one things he loves the most, but whenever I read this novel it feels like the Mc should be a normal boy from earth who reincarnated into a magical world with modern science knowledge. Aside from when the author reminds us of his previous life as a old grand sage I always see the Mc as a normal kid. His interactions with other people whether they be adults or kids his age have no semblance of a reincarnated sage. And whenever the contrast does appear it breaks my immersion which is a bit annoying. In my opinion this novel would be much better if the Mc was either a normal child with some lucky encounters or a magic loving human from earth. If you can look past that issue then this novel is well written and fun to read.
